▼ Not recommended 75 hrs

Absolute waste of time. At the beginning youre making good progress. Even when youre starting out working with the Slime Bank, everything is still going great. but once youre at about a 370k Slime Coin cap and start to get all skills to lvl 200 minimum, youre starting to realize that you only have a few more ways to progress, each more grindy than the other. Up until this point I havent touched alchemy, because you need longer runs for that, so I looked into it. Only to find out that the most powerful ability of alchemy is to push for another zone with potions or to reduce the level of challenge bosses with potions. So what is the best way to progress now? Right, lowering the Slime King challenge boss and using that to quick farm for rebirth points. First you need 8k rb points on each char, then 16k, then 32k, and so on. And once youre decently far into the game, a single RB run at 5-10 mins will net you about 2-4k points. So have fun grinding the same ♥♥♥♥ over and over and over again, so you can push for a new higher zone reached. Or you can also start capturing monsters to fulfill missions. Once again a mindless active grind. I was wondering where this all leads to and lo and behold: It ends in the most annoying boss fight in 5-4 that even people with 100 times higher stats than me cant clear (You can check Kongegreate forums for more discussion on that). And whats after all the grind? Reincarnation aka full reset with benefits, so a 2nd prestige layer. I looked at the perks. 20% more RB points for one of them.... THANK YOU, now i dont have to grind for 200 hours but only for ~170h, wow, great way to value my time. I suggest you dont even start this game. The beginning is fun and youll want to reach more mechanics, but suddenly at one point it all grinds to a stop and it stacks one annoyance on top of the other until you dont wanna play anymore.

▼ Not recommended 223 hrs

[h2]THIS IS NOT AN IDLE GAME ![/H2] Pretty nice game, lots of fun in the first hours. BUT! After some time of playing + It does not feel fully balanced. + important QoL features are hidden in the Epic store (real money) + The grind is real + far from a real idler, at the same time missing the fun of properly active playing + clicking through the bosses every x minutes is definitely no fun, you need it for quests tho and the lower bosses take too long, still you have to complete them hundres of times. did you forget your game is an idler/auto battler? + droprate of important things later on is way too low (introduce pity timer?)
